哇哦,你有没有想过,那些在手机屏幕上翩翩起舞的游戏人物,是怎么从无到有,一步步跃然于我们眼前的呢?今天,就让我带你一探究竟,揭秘游戏人物安卓建模的神奇之旅吧!
你还记得当年用Android开发游戏时,画一个图都让人头疼,纹理还得自己写代码,真是够呛。后来,我遇到了Unity,画图变得简单多了,很多东西不用写代码就能搞定。但人物角色呢?原来,秘密就在于.FBX格式的动画和模型。一般.FBX文件都是用3DS MAX和Maya软件导出的,而我现在用的就是3DS MAX。安装它可不容易,还得注册机呢!
在3DS MAX里,建模就像是在搭建一个微缩的世界。首先,你需要准备好你的舞台——场景。在这个舞台上,你的游戏人物将会登场。接下来,就是建模的环节了。
1. 基础建模:从简单的几何体开始,比如球体、立方体等,通过拉伸、缩放、旋转等操作,逐渐塑造出人物的大致轮廓。
2. 细化细节:在基础模型的基础上,添加更多的细节,如头发、衣服、饰品等。这一步需要耐心和细心,因为细节决定着人物的最终效果。
3. 材质与纹理:给模型贴上合适的材质和纹理,让人物看起来更加真实。这需要你对各种材质和纹理有一定的了解。
在3DS MAX中完成建模后,接下来就是将模型导入Unity3D,为角色赋予生命。
1. 导入模型:将3DS MAX中制作好的.FBX文件导入Unity3D。
2. 设置动画:在Unity3D中,为角色设置动画,让角色能够做出各种动作。
3. 调整灯光和摄像机:为了让角色在游戏中看起来更加生动,需要调整灯光和摄像机。
自学游戏建模需要时间和耐心。以下是一些建议:
1. 学习建模软件:如3DS MAX、Maya等,需要花费1-2周的时间来了解软件的基本操作和功能。
2. 学习建模技巧:了解不同游戏场景、道具的建模技巧,如建模细节、纹理、动画等。
3. 练习建模:不断地练习建模,尝试制作不同的游戏场景、道具,不断挑战自己的技能和创造力。
手机游戏制作需要有编程基础,所以你必须先学会程序开发技术。现在主流的手机游戏开发平台是iOS(苹果)和Android(安卓),对应的开发技术分别是:
1. iOS(苹果)开发语言:C、Object-C
2. Android(安卓)开发语言:Java(J2ME)
建议如下:
1. 首先选定你想从事开发的平台,比如iOS或Android。
2. 确定平台后再选择一门开发语言学习,学习的方法分自学和参加培训班两种。
3. 学成语言后再学习游戏相关开发技术:如策划、建模等等。
易模是一款手机3D建模软件,打破了3D建模专业认知,用手机扫描就能创建模型。随时随地可对物品进行扫描,自动构建出3D模型,可以浏览、编辑、分享、下载模型,还可进行AR展示、脸部建模以及场景建模。
易模软件功能:
1. 可以直接对接3d打印机,轻轻松松便可完成建模打印的全流程。
2. 操作简便,一键式操作,无需额外学习软件,上手快,用起来更加舒心。
3. 全程采用自然光进行扫描,无扫描光线的隐患,安全有保障,孩子也可放心使用。
4. 使用蓝牙进行连接,无线快速传输,可以随时随地灵活地使用,告别接线带来的烦恼。
Nomad Sculpt建模软件是一款极具实力的建模工具,它为用户提供了高效便捷的建模与绘画体验,支持丰富的自定义笔触和画笔设置,同时具备出色的物理渲染能力,能够帮助用户精准完成细节建模操作,非常适合有需求的用户下载使用。
Nomad Sculpt建模软件功能:
1. 图层管理:通过独立的图层记录每一次雕刻和绘画操作,使用户能够在创作过程中更加灵活地调整和优化作品细节。
2. 多分辨率切换:支持在不同分辨率的网格间自由切换,帮助用户构建更流畅的工作流程,从粗略轮廓到精细修饰一气呵成。
3. 体素重塑技术:利用体素重塑功能快速生成统一细节水平的网格,尤其适合在创作初期用于快速勾勒基础形状。
4. 高质量渲染效果:内置精美的PP渲染引擎,默认